Mesquite, NV - On Wednesday, February 23, from 6-7 pm, The Virgin Valley Heritage Museum and Virgin Valley Historical Society will be hosting the first Founders Forum of 2022. The event will be held at City Hall in the Council Chambers 10 E Mesquite Blvd, Mesquite, NV 89027.

The Relief Society House is one of the older buildings in town and served as the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ter Saints Women’s Auxiliary (Relief Society)  meeting house. The purpose of the building was to provide a meeting place for the local women where they could provide service to the community, grow personally and support and strengthen their families. The building was later sold and eventually became the home of Wes and Verde Hughes and their twelve children.


Come and learn what makes this building unique to Mesquite and what the future holds for it.
